Transaction 839bf860aaf6914efc3cce156ba3aefd1788e6840c26c20c48a67dfb7fa77c26

1 Input
2 Outputs
  • 839bf860aaf6914efc3cce156ba3aefd1788e6840c26c20c48a67dfb7fa77c26:0
  • value  229030
    address  3GDKPyHrCkrhy2STwGNh6MBc6iaXZNAezc
  • 839bf860aaf6914efc3cce156ba3aefd1788e6840c26c20c48a67dfb7fa77c26:1
  • value  79692570
    address  18He7C8MDYWmrPqgkgdSCDL4Ny4nCkQCmb